New Player Enters Solana ETF Race

Nashville-based digital asset manager Canary Capital has submitted a filing to the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) for a spot Solana exchange-traded fund (ETF), adding to the growing list of companies seeking regulatory approval for SOL-based investment products.

The filing for the Canary Solana ETF marks another milestone in the expanding cryptocurrency ETF landscape, following the company’s recent applications for XRP and Litecoin products.

SOL’s Market Performance and Ecosystem

Solana (SOL), currently the fifth-largest cryptocurrency by market capitalization, has demonstrated remarkable growth with its value increasing by 400% over the past year. At approximately $175 per token, SOL’s total market capitalization stands at $82 billion.

The Solana blockchain has gained prominence as an alternative to Ethereum, offering:

  • Lower transaction costs
  • Faster processing speeds
  • Support for decentralized applications (dapps)
  • Robust decentralized finance (DeFi) ecosystem
  • Growing meme coin marketplace

ETF Landscape and Regulatory Environment

The cryptocurrency ETF market has seen significant developments in 2024:

  • Bitcoin ETFs received approval in January
  • Ethereum ETFs began trading in July
  • Established firms VanEck and 21Shares filed Solana ETF applications in June

However, the regulatory path for Solana ETFs faces unique challenges. The SEC has specifically identified SOL as a potential unregistered security, which could complicate the approval process.

Political and Regulatory Implications

The timeline for potential Solana ETF approvals may depend on several factors:

  • Outcome of upcoming U.S. elections
  • Duration of Gary Gensler’s tenure as SEC Chairman
  • Resolution of regulatory concerns regarding SOL’s security status

Market analysts maintain a positive long-term outlook for Solana ETF approval, following the precedent set by Bitcoin and Ethereum products. However, the timing remains uncertain due to regulatory complexities.

Investment Implications

If approved, the Canary Solana ETF would provide traditional investors with several benefits:

  • Exposure to SOL’s price movement through familiar stock exchange mechanisms
  • Elimination of cryptocurrency custody concerns
  • Integration with existing investment portfolios
  • Potential tax advantages through regulated structure

Canary Capital, established in September, aims to bridge the gap between institutional investors and cryptocurrency markets by providing professional trading and management solutions. This ETF filing represents a significant step in their mission to expand institutional access to digital assets.
